Marc Jacobs

Marc Jacobs debuted their 2019 Spring Collection at New York Fashion Week on September 12th, 2018. The 55 piece collection featured bright, playful colour schemes, drawing to its ‘Candyland’ theme. The collection also noted hints of 80s fashion using elements such as strong shoulder pads and high waisted pants. Mini dresses featured extravagant ruffled details and satin fabrics.

Proenza Schouler

American designers Jack McCollough and Lazaro Hernandez, the designer duo behind Proenza Schouler were back in New York for their Spring 2019 show!

The brand took a break from the Big Apple to spend some time in the Paris Fashion Week circuit. Now that the duo is back in America they’ve realized that they no longer want to create ‘special occasion’ couture wear but instead create clothing for the everyday woman.

The collection was reflective of their time away from home with European elements combined with American styles. The showcase consisted of garments made from classic materials such as denim, cotton and leather. The designers played with interesting silhouettes and made unconventional adjustments to staple pieces. The collection featured blazer-style denim jackets, drop waist dresses made in denim and various fabrics as well as shiny vests and silver button ups. The looks were definitely a refreshingly unique take on everyday wear.
